CHTR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2021 in Review

1,044 of the 6,498 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Charter Communications (CHTR) for Q4 2021, worth a combined $78.4B — down 14% from $90.9B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 154 funds opened new CHTR positions and 106 closed out — a net gain of 48 holders — while 327 added to existing stakes and 379 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Veritas Asset Management, adding an estimated $430M. The largest seller was Fidelity Investments, cutting an estimated $862M.
